Chinese National swimming Championships: A Showcase of Emerging Talent

the recent ‍Chinese‍ National Swimming Championships highlighted the extraordinary skills ⁤of Li ‌Bingjie and Qin Haiyang,two athletes who are making important ⁣waves in their respective events. Li’s ‌outstanding performances in freestyle swimming have ​not only captivated fans but also set⁢ a high​ standard for the ​upcoming international competitions. Meanwhile, Qin’s impressive victory in ‌the​ men’s⁤ 50-metre⁤ breaststroke emphasizes the ⁣depth of talent ‌within Chinese ‍swimming, marking him as​ one ​of the‍ sport’s promising figures. Together,‌ these‍ athletes​ have ⁢reinforced China’s reputation on the global swimming ⁤stage and generated excitement for future tournaments.

Li Bingjie Excels in ⁤Freestyle events

Li Bingjie has made a remarkable impact at this ‍year’s Chinese⁢ Nationals by achieving record-breaking times that have enthralled both spectators ​and experts alike. Her unusual speed and flawless technique led to multiple podium ⁢finishes, firmly establishing her as a leading figure in ⁣competitive⁣ swimming. Notably, she shattered national ⁢records ⁣in both‌ the 100m and 200m freestyle, showcasing her⁤ relentless​ pursuit of​ excellence ​and setting new⁢ standards ‍for future competitors.

The enthusiasm from ‌fans during her races served as an inspiration to many aspiring swimmers. Li’s ⁢rigorous training⁤ regimen focuses on enhancing physical endurance alongside‌ mental⁤ fortitude—a topic ‍gaining traction among coaches nationwide. The ‌championships also featured remarkable performances from other competitors like Qin Haiyang, who ​triumphed in his event—the 50m breaststroke. their ⁢combined ‍achievements ⁢signify ⁢a new era ⁢of athletic excellence within China’s swimming community.

Qin Haiyang Wins 50 Breaststroke Title

in an electrifying⁣ display ⁤of⁤ speed⁢ and precision, Qin ⁣Haiyang secured first place in the 50m breaststroke at this year’s ⁢championships—further ‍solidifying his ‌position among ​China’s elite swimmers.His ​impressive time demonstrated not only his ​explosive start but also his ​exceptional underwater technique that captivated audiences‍ throughout ‌his⁤ race. This victory marks a​ significant milestone for Qin as he prepares to compete internationally.

This win highlights key‌ aspects that​ contributed to his success:

  • Pace Setting: an explosive ⁢start allowed ⁣him⁣ to take an early lead.
  • Tactical Turns: His ‌seamless⁣ flip turn​ helped maintain momentum crucial for sprint events.
  • Pushing‍ Through to Finish: A powerful finish ⁤ensured⁢ he held onto his‌ lead untill crossing the finish ​line.
